This list consists of people who reached the summit of Mount Everest more than once. By 2013, 6,871 summits have been recorded by 4,042 people. Despite two hard years of disaster (2014 and 2015), by the end of 2016 there were 7,646 summits by 4,469 people. In 2024 about 800 people summited, breaking the record for most in one year compared to 2013, in which 667 summited Mount Everest.
